Warning Signs You Need Attic Water Removal

Ignoring these warning signs can lead to costly damage and health risks. Our team has seen it happen, and we’re here to help you avoid the same fate. Be on the lookout for: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Unpleasant odors in your attic or crawlspace can be a sign of mold growth. Ignoring this issue can lead to health risks and further damage. Our technicians are certified by the IICRC and will work with you to identify and remove the source of the odor. Don’t delay!

Water Stains on Your Ceiling or Walls

Water stains can be a sign of a larger issue, including roof leaks or plumbing problems. Ignoring this issue can lead to costly repairs and further damage. Our technicians will work with you to identify the source of the stain and develop a plan to fix it. Don’t wait!

Warped or Buckled Ceiling Tiles

Warped or buckled ceiling tiles can be a sign of water damage. Ignoring this issue can lead to further damage and health risks. Our technicians will work with you to identify the source of the issue and develop a plan to fix it. Call us now!

Attic Water Removal Cost In Celina, TX

The cost of attic water removal in Celina, TX, varies dep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and removal $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Attic drying and d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ment used
Antimicrobial treatment services $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of microbial contaminants
